Robert Half(RHI) - 2025 Q3 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-10-22 22:02
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Global enterprise revenues for Q3 2025 were $1.354 billion, down 8% year-over-year on both reported and adjusted bases [3][4] - Net income per share decreased to $0.43 from $0.64 in the same quarter last year [4] - Cash flow from operations was $77 million, with a cash dividend of $0.59 per share distributed, totaling $59 million [5]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Talent Solutions revenues were $649 million in the U.S., down 11% year-over-year, while non-U.S. revenues were $207 million, down 12% [6] - Protiviti's global revenues were $498 million, with U.S. revenues at $398 million (down 6%) and non-U.S. revenues at $100 million (up 8%) [7] - Contract Talent Solutions bill rates increased by 3.7% compared to the previous year [7]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The third quarter had 64.2 billing days compared to 64.1 in the same quarter last year, while the fourth quarter is expected to have 61.4 billing days [6] - Currency exchange rate movements positively impacted reported revenues by $9 million [6]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company aims to capitalize on emerging opportunities in staffing and consulting services, leveraging its brand, technology, and talent [5][15] - Protiviti's pipeline is growing, and the company expects improvements in growth rates in Q4 [17][42]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management noted early signs of improvement in the macroeconomic environment, with increased client discussions about staffing and hiring [15][16] - The company remains committed to its dividend policy, with free cash flow covering the dividend despite recent downturns in the staffing industry [25][26] Other Important Information - The adjusted operating income for Q3 was $61 million, or 4.5% of revenue, with a tax rate of 33% [10][12] - The company has $360 million in cash on the balance sheet, providing a cushion for future operations [25] Q&A Session Summary Question: Regarding Protiviti's pipeline and project materialization - Management confirmed that the pipeline is growing and projects are materializing as expected, though they are replacing larger projects with smaller ones, impacting efficiency [21][22] Question: Sustainability of the dividend - Management emphasized the importance of the dividend and confirmed that free cash flow currently covers it, with a commitment to return cash to shareholders [25][26] Question: Fourth quarter revenue guidance - Management described the fourth quarter guidance as conservative, with expectations for slight sequential growth [29] Question: Trends in permanent placement versus contract - Management noted that permanent placements are currently performing better than contract placements, which is counterintuitive but reflects current market dynamics [36] Question: Protiviti's gross margin compression - Management attributed gross margin compression to inflation, competitive pressures, and a shift to smaller, lower-margin projects [42][43] Question: Long-term operating margin opportunities - Management highlighted the importance of moving up the skill curve and leveraging technology to improve margins over the next cycle [48][49] Question: Impact of government shutdown on revenue - Management indicated that the federal government contributes less than half of 1% to revenue, and no significant impact from the shutdown is expected [51] Question: AI's impact on the labor market - Management expressed confidence that AI has not significantly impacted the staffing industry, attributing recent downturns to client caution and reduced contractor usage [56][65]
IBM(IBM) - 2025 Q3 - Earnings Call Presentation
2025-10-22 21:00
Financial Performance Highlights - IBM's revenue grew by over 7% year-over-year[14] - Adjusted EBITDA increased by 22%[14] - Operating earnings per share grew by 15%[14] - Free cash flow year-to-date grew by 9%[14] - The company is raising its full-year free cash flow outlook to approximately $14 billion[22] Segment Performance - Software revenue increased by 9%, with Automation growing by 22% and Hybrid Cloud by 12%[16] - Infrastructure revenue increased by 15%, driven by a 59% increase in IBM Z revenue[18] - Consulting revenue increased by 2%[20], with over $1.5 billion in GenAI bookings in the quarter[19] Key Metrics and Outlook - The GenAI book of business now exceeds $9.5 billion[11] - The company is raising revenue growth expectations to over 5%[22] - Adjusted EBITDA growth is expected to be in the mid-teens[22]

Can Broadcom's Expanding Portfolio Push Up Q4 Semiconductor Sales?
ZACKS· 2025-10-22 16:00
Group 1: Company Performance and Projections - Broadcom's Semiconductor revenues are benefiting from strong demand for XPUs, which constitute 65% of AI revenues in Q3 fiscal 2025, and the expanding portfolio is expected to further boost sales in fiscal 2025 [1] - AI revenues for Q4 fiscal 2025 are projected to increase by 66% year over year to $6.2 billion, while Semiconductor sales are expected to grow by 30% year over year to $10.7 billion [4][10] - The Zacks Consensus Estimate for Semiconductor sales is pegged at $10.76 billion, indicating a growth of 30.8% from the previous year [4] Group 2: Product Launches and Innovations - In June, Broadcom announced the shipment of Tomahawk 6, the world's first 102.4 terabits per second Ethernet switch, and has since started shipping Tomahawk 6 – Davisson, its third-generation Co-Packaged Optics Ethernet switch [2] - The Jericho 4 Ethernet fabric router announced in August can interconnect over one million XPUs across multiple data centers, and the Thor Ultra, announced recently, is the first 800G AI Ethernet Network Interface Card capable of supporting trillion-parameter AI workloads [3] - New launches like Tomahawk 6 and Thor Ultra are strengthening Broadcom's AI networking portfolio [10] Group 3: Competitive Landscape - Broadcom faces stiff competition in the semiconductor market from NVIDIA and Marvell Technology [5] - NVIDIA's networking revenues surged by 98% year over year to $7.3 billion, driven by strong demand for AI compute clusters [6] - Marvell Technology is benefiting from strong data center demand, with its Cloud and on-premise Ethernet switching accounting for 74% of net revenues in Q2 fiscal 2026 [7] Group 4: Stock Performance and Valuation - Broadcom shares have appreciated by 47.8% year to date, outperforming the broader Zacks Computer and Technology sector's return of 24.5% [8] - The stock is trading at a forward 12-month price/earnings ratio of 37.83X, compared to the sector's 29.41X, indicating a premium valuation [12] - The Zacks Consensus Estimate for fiscal 2025 earnings is pegged at $6.73 per share, suggesting a growth of 38.2% from fiscal 2024 [15]
GM is bringing Google Gemini-powered AI assistant to cars in 2026
TechCrunch· 2025-10-22 15:00
Core Insights - General Motors (GM) will introduce a conversational AI assistant powered by Google Gemini in its vehicles starting next year [1] - The rollout of Google Gemini is part of several technology-focused announcements made at GM's Forward event, with other features not expected until 2028 [2] - GM's integration of Gemini aligns with industry trends, as other automakers like Stellantis, Mercedes, and Tesla are also adopting generative AI assistants [3] Technology Integration - GM vehicles already feature "Google built-in," allowing access to Google Assistant and other applications through the infotainment system [4] - The new AI assistant aims to facilitate more natural conversations and assist with tasks such as drafting messages and planning routes with additional stops [5] - GM's long-term goal includes developing a custom-built AI that connects to vehicle systems via OnStar, enhancing the in-car experience [6] User Experience and Control - The assistant will provide maintenance alerts, route suggestions, and explanations of car features, while also allowing users to control the information it can access [9] - GM emphasizes user control over data access, especially in light of recent controversies regarding the sale of customer driving and geolocation data [10]
Anthropic and Google Negotiating Multibillion-Dollar Computing Partnership
PYMNTS.com· 2025-10-22 14:40
Core Insights - Anthropic is in early discussions with Google for a cloud-computing agreement valued in the high tens of billions of dollars, which would enhance its access to Google's tensor processing units designed for machine learning [1][3] - Google has invested approximately $3 billion in Anthropic, making it a key cloud provider, and a larger deal could expand Google's presence in the generative AI infrastructure market [3][4] - Anthropic recently raised $13 billion, increasing its valuation to $183 billion, reflecting the growing economics of AI scale [4] Group 1 - The potential partnership with Google highlights the importance of proprietary compute infrastructure in the AI race [1] - Anthropic's Claude models are central to enterprise adoption, providing multimodal reasoning and compliance tools for regulated industries [4] - The company is extending its platform into developer tools and automation, positioning its models as infrastructure for AI-native applications [5] Group 2 - Amazon has committed up to $8 billion to Anthropic, making it one of the largest users of its custom AI chips [6] - The discussions with Google would solidify Anthropic's multi-cloud strategy, ensuring access to advanced silicon and redundancy [6] - Securing Anthropic as a long-term client could enhance Google's competitive position against Amazon and Microsoft in the cloud AI supply chain [6]
Taylor Morrison (TMHC) Q3 2025 Earnings Transcript
Yahoo Finance· 2025-10-22 14:17
Core Insights - The company is focusing on innovative incentives and pricing strategies to enhance buyer confidence and affordability, particularly in well-located communities [1][3] - Despite challenging market conditions, the company reported strong third-quarter results, exceeding guidance on key metrics such as home closings volume and gross margin [3][22] - The company is strategically managing its inventory and starts volume based on community-specific conditions, with a balanced approach to pricing and incentives [4][23] Financial Performance - The company reported net income of $201 million or $2.01 per diluted share, with adjusted net income at $211 million or $2.11 per diluted share [22] - Home closings revenue reached $2 billion from delivering 3,324 homes, slightly exceeding guidance [22] - The average closing price of homes was $602,000, above the guidance of approximately $600,000 [22] Market Dynamics - Monthly net absorption rates improved throughout the quarter, with September showing the strongest pace since May, attributed to favorable mortgage interest rates [7] - The company experienced a 155% increase in attendance for its national home buying webinar, indicating growing consumer interest [8] - The mix of orders by buyer groups remained consistent, with 30% entry-level, 51% move-up, and 19% resort lifestyle [10] Inventory and Land Management - The company controls 84,564 homebuilding lots, with 60% of the supply managed through options and off-balance sheet structures, enhancing capital efficiency [15][16] - Recent negotiations resulted in an 8% average price reduction on nearly 3,400 lots, reflecting favorable land acquisition conditions [18][19] - The company expects to invest approximately $2.3 billion in homebuilding land this year, down from earlier projections [19] Consumer Engagement and Technology - The company launched an AI-powered digital assistant to enhance customer engagement and streamline the home buying process [6] - The digital assistant provides personalized, data-driven guidance, improving the online shopping experience for potential buyers [6] - The company is expanding its tech-enabled sales tools to drive cost efficiencies and enhance customer experience [5] Strategic Outlook - The company anticipates opening over 100 new communities in 2026, aiming for mid to high single-digit outlet growth [12][29] - The company is focused on balancing the mix of to-be-built and spec homes based on customer demand, with a current mix of approximately 70% spec and 30% to-be-built [13] - The company remains committed to addressing housing affordability and collaborating with stakeholders to improve access to homeownership [33][37]
